thede

English

/θiːd/

noun
Definitions
  • (UK) A nation; people.
  • (UK) A country; land; kingdom.

Etymology

Inherited from Middle English thede inherited from Old English þēod (people, nation, tribe, race, a nation, language, country) inherited from *þeudu inherited from Proto-Germanic *þeudō (people, nation) inherited from Proto-Indo-European *tewtéh₂ (people, tribe, heap, nation).
